Everyone knows about the “For Dummies” books. Famous around the world, these books are developed to simplify complicated topics so that everyone can comprehend them. “Job Interviews for Dummies” by Joyce Lain Kennedy follows in that tradition. It’s an easy to read book that gives tips for succeeding at job interviews.

Book Contents

  • Preparation advice and strategies.
  • Reduce job interview anxiety.
  • Supply winning answers to difficult questions.
  • Work your qualifications in effective ways.
  • Salary negotiation tips.

Benefits of Book

As usual, Job Interviews For Dummies reflects content in a straight forward manner in terms that are both simple and entertaining. The writing of the book is light hearted and keeps you fascinated with an order to the topics that makes sense.

One aspect of Job Interviews for Dummies that makes it distinctive is the information on surviving personality tests, as well as data on evaluating the job offer and how to decide when to walk away. Job Interviews for Dummies is, like all of the “For Dummies” series, informative and rich in tips and suggestion.

Weaknesses of Book

Though it might not be fair to the author or the intention of the book, the fact that the job interview book is ONLY about the interviews is yet a mark against it. Several other books give similar information while still offering tips for job searching, resumes, etc. That makes this book less precious, even if it finally was not designed for that purpose.

Additionally, “Job Interviews for Dummies” doesn’t really give any new or groundbreaking information. It’s simply a culmination of general (though beneficial) tips about interviews. It is nothing more, nothing less. In several ways that is all you require, but if you’ve read an in depth interview book before, the information might be less helpful. It’s also not written for graduates. It is written more as a general reference.

Overall Impressions

Job Interviews for Dummies” is a great interview reference, particularly for beginners and those that feel they require a lot of help in case to be victorious in interviews. It’s more of a basic reference in contrast to an encyclopedia of job interview information, but that is okay, because its primary intention is to assist make interviews simpler for those that struggle, and it succeeds in that regard.
